Treatment For Adults Adhd Treatment ADHD

Counseling (psychotherapy) and medications are used to treat people suffering from adhd. The medications used are stimulants and nonstimulants, as well as certain antidepressants. It may take time to find the correct dosage and medication. It is crucial to monitor your clinical condition regularly.

People with ADHD are more likely to forget appointments and responsibilities. They also tend to make impulsive choices and have difficulty maintaining relationships. Therapy and classes that teach communication skills can help.

Stimulants

Stimulants are the most frequently prescribed treatment for ADHD in adults. They boost the levels of neurotransmitters in the brain, which affect attention and impulsivity.

About 70% of people who suffer from ADHD respond to stimulant medications. They can reduce hyperactivity and fidgeting. They can also improve organization and help people complete tasks. They can also improve relationships. They can have serious adverse effects. Some of them include loss of appetite, headaches, and trouble sleeping. These side effects usually subside with time. The majority of stimulants are classified into two classes of drugs: amphetamines and methylphenidates. Methylphenidates are the most popular and have less side effects than amphetamines. They work by increasing the levels of norepinephrine. This chemical aids people to focus and control impulses. Amphetamines are more powerful than methylphenidates. They can cause more adverse effects. They may cause dryness of the mouth, increased blood pressure, and a rapid heart rate.

Long-acting stimulant drugs are the norm for treatment of ADHD for adults. They last for up to 24 hour. People who use them regularly notice they have better control over their attention, focus, and impulse control. They also help people feel more calm and relaxed. These medications are preferred by the majority of patients over short-acting drugs that can be only taken as needed and last up to four hours. These medicines are a great option for those who forget to take their medication on a regular basis throughout the day or worry about not taking it at work or school.

Non-stimulant drugs for adhd in adults treatment take longer to start working than stimulants. They can be utilized as a test to determine the appropriate medication for you or in combination with stimulants. They don't pose the same addiction or risk of abuse as stimulants, but they can still trigger issues such as insomnia and irritability. Examples of these medications include atomoxetine (Strateva) and bupropion (Wellbutrin).

Cognitive behavioral therapy for ADHD in adulthood is a kind of therapy that helps improve self-esteem, Adults Adhd Treatment relationships, and organizational abilities. It is focused on changing negative thoughts that can lead to poor behavior and developing coping skills. This type of CBT usually occurs in a group.

A study showed that when those with adhd treatment in adults participated in an CBT program that they improved their ability to manage their time and also their social and work life. It also helped to reduce symptoms like impulsivity and depression.

Counseling in the family or marriage can help spouses or partners with ADHD learn to support them without blaming the loved one for the issues caused by ADHD. It can also teach them how to lessen conflicts in their relationships by talking more honestly about their requirements and expectations.
